When were vapes invented and who invented e-cigarettes?

The concept of vaping, or using an electronic device to vapourise a liquid and inhale the resulting vapor, has been around for many years. However, the first modern e-cigarette is generally credited to a Chinese pharmacist named Hon Lik, who invented the first vaping device in 2003.

Hon Lik’s e-cigarette used a battery-powered heating element to vapourise a liquid solution, which typically contained nicotine, propylene glycol, and flavorings. The device was designed as an alternative to smoking and was intended to provide users with a way to inhale nicotine without the harmful smoke and chemicals produced by burning tobacco.

Since its invention, the e-cigarette has evolved and there are now many different types and brands of e-cigarettes available on the market. Vaping has also become popular among people who are trying to quit smoking or who are looking for a less harmful alternative to traditional cigarettes.
